Pros
Pro Preconfigured for convenience
Over 80 popular apps and shortcuts have been preconfigured upon installation of the app making for an easy experience right out of the box to get going.

Pro Anyone can use it
It is free to use as it is donation-funded.
Pro Fast access and setup
It enables you to launch any application with very few clicks. If you organize your apps well, you get them in one single click. You may need two or three at most if you need to open a folder or move to another page. HotCorners is a great idea, allowing you to view WinLaunch without even clicking.
Even setting up your apps in it is fast and intuitive, with simple clicks and drag-n-drops.
Cons
Con Does not auto index
This means that users will have to manually setup any shortcuts or apps that they want launched that were not already preconfigured. This can be time consuming for the user.

Con Inconvenient manual setup
After installed the first time you pull the launcher up there will be no apps contained within, this means every user will have to manually add the apps they would like in the launcher, which is time consuming. An auto population feature would be more convenient, sadly there is none.
